Word Equation Aluminium + Iron (II) Nitrate = Aluminum Nitrate + Iron Al + Fe (NO3)2 = Al (NO3)3 + Fe is a Single Displacement (Substitution) reaction where two moles of solid Aluminium [Al] and three moles of aqueous Iron (II) Nitrate [Fe (NO 3) 2] react to form two moles of aqueous Aluminum Nitrate [Al (NO 3) 3] and three moles of solid Iron [Fe] Iron + Aluminum Nitrate = Aluminium + Iron (II) Nitrate Fe + Al (NO3)3 = Al + Fe (NO3)2 is a Single Displacement (Substitution) reaction where three moles of solid Iron [Fe] and two moles of aqueous Aluminum Nitrate [Al (NO 3) 3] react to form two moles of solid Aluminium [Al] and three moles of aqueous Iron (II) Nitrate [Fe (NO 3) 2] See full list on webqc. Iron (II) nitrate, Fe (NO3 )2 Jan 3, 2024 · The reaction between solid aluminum and iron (II) nitrate results in solid iron and aqueous aluminum nitrate, illustrating a single displacement reaction.
